What does SQL mean?
Definition and explanation
Why it matters in sales
TL;DR
What does SQL mean?
Welcome to our comprehensive analysis of SQL, a fundamental concept in the world of sales and business analytics. In this article, we will explore the meaning of SQL, why it matters to sales, and the key factors that impact it. So, let's dive in!
The Meaning of SQL
SQL, short for Structured Query Language, is a programming language specifically designed for managing and manipulating relational databases. It provides a standardized way to interact with databases, allowing users to store, retrieve, update, and analyze data efficiently.
Why SQL Matters to Sales
SQL plays a crucial role in sales as it enables organizations to extract valuable insights from vast amounts of data. Sales teams heavily rely on data analysis to understand customer behavior, identify trends, and make informed decisions to drive revenue growth.
By utilizing SQL, sales professionals can:
- Perform complex queries to filter and sort data, enabling them to target specific customer segments more effectively.
- Create reports and generate visualizations, making it easier to communicate key metrics and sales performance to stakeholders.
- Analyze historical sales data to identify patterns and forecast future sales, supporting strategic planning and goal setting.
- Integrate and combine data from different sources, such as CRM systems and marketing platforms, to gain a holistic view of customer interactions.
The Key Factors Impacting SQL
Several factors influence the performance and effectiveness of SQL in a sales context. Let's take a closer look at some of the most significant ones:
Data Quality and Integrity
Accurate and reliable data is crucial for meaningful SQL analysis. Incomplete or inconsistent data can lead to misleading insights and unreliable decision-making. It is essential to ensure data is properly cleaned, validated, and maintained to derive accurate conclusions.
Query Optimization
Efficient query design is vital to minimize execution time and maximize performance. By optimizing SQL queries, sales professionals can dramatically improve response times and enhance productivity. Techniques such as indexing, query rewriting, and using appropriate join methods are commonly employed to achieve optimization.
Data Security
In an era of increasing data breaches and privacy concerns, protecting sensitive sales data is of utmost importance. SQL provides various security mechanisms such as user authentication, data encryption, and access controls to safeguard critical information and comply with industry regulations.
Scalability and Performance
As sales data volumes grow, the scalability and performance of SQL databases become essential considerations. With proper database design, indexing, and hardware optimization, organizations can ensure that SQL systems can handle large data sets and deliver responsive performance, even during peak usage periods.
Data Integration
With the proliferation of disparate data sources, integrating data from various systems has become a challenge. SQL offers powerful features like data joins and unions, allowing sales teams to combine and transform data from different sources into a unified format, facilitating more comprehensive analysis.
The Tradeoffs and Challenges
While SQL offers tremendous benefits to sales organizations, it is essential to consider the tradeoffs and challenges involved:
- Complexity: SQL can be complex, requiring a solid understanding of database concepts and the language itself. Adequate training and expertise are necessary to utilize SQL effectively.
- Resource Requirements: Managing and maintaining SQL databases may require significant resources, both in terms of skilled personnel and infrastructure. Organizations need to allocate appropriate resources to ensure smooth operations.
- Data Governance: Establishing robust data governance practices is crucial to ensure data quality, security, and compliance. Organizations must have clear policies and processes in place to manage SQL databases effectively.
- Adaptability: SQL is a continuously evolving language with frequent updates and new features. Keeping up with the latest developments and best practices is vital to harness its full potential.
The Importance of Considering the Impact
When making decisions regarding SQL, it is paramount to consider the broader impact on sales operations and the organization as a whole. Any modifications or upgrades to SQL systems should be thoroughly evaluated for potential effects on data integrity, performance, and user experiences.
By carefully analyzing the benefits, costs, and risks associated with SQL implementations, sales leaders can make informed choices that align with their strategic objectives and drive business success.
In Conclusion
SQL, the backbone of relational databases, plays an indispensable role in sales operations, enabling efficient data management, analysis, and decision-making. Understanding the meaning of SQL, its impact on sales, and the key factors surrounding it is crucial for sales professionals to thrive in today's data-driven business environment.
Remember, SQL is not just a tool but a gateway to valuable insights that can unlock new possibilities and drive sales growth. Embrace it, master it, and leverage it to achieve sales excellence!